Java编程基础

Java编程基础(电脑的32位和64位区别是什么)

Java基本语法

Java程序的基本格式

修饰符 class 类名{
    程序代码
}

[^每行代码必须要用分号结尾,注意不要误写成中文的分号;严格区分大小写;常用的编排方式是一行只写一条语句,符号“{”与语句同行,“}”独占一行;Java程序中一个连续的字符串不能分成两行书写;为便于阅读,可以将一行较长的字符串分两行书写,然后用(+)连接。//字符串或串(String)是由数字、字母、下划线组成的一串字符。一般记为 s=“a1a2···an”(n>=0)。它是编程语言中表示文本的数据类型//]:

Java中的注释

  • 单行注释 //定义一个整体变量

  • 多行注释

    /* int c = 10
    */
    
  • 文档注释

    /**
    *@author(作者)
    *@version(版本)
    */
    

Java中的标识符

在程序编写中,经常需要在程序中定义一些符号标记一些名称,如包名,类名,方法名,参数名,变量名等,这些符号叫作标识符。

标识符可以由字母、数字、下划线和美元符号组成,但标识符不能以数字开头,不能是Java中的关键字。


为了增强代码的可读性,建议初学者在定义标识符时还应该遵循以下规则:

  1. 包名的所有字母一律小写,如cn.itcast.test。
  2. 类名和接口名每个单词的首字母都要大写,如ArraList,Iterator。
  3. 常量名的所有字母都要大写,单词之间用下划线连接,如DAY_OF_MONTH。
  4. 变量名和方法名的第一个单词首字母小写,从第二个单词开始每个单词首字母大写,如lineNumber,getLineNumber。
  5. 在程序中,应该尽量使用有意义的英文单词定义标识符,以便于阅读。例如,使用userName定义用户名,使用password定义密码。

Java中的关键字

abstract、assert、boolean、break、byte、case、catch、char、class、const、

continue、default、do、double、else、enum、extends、false、final、finally、

float、for、goto、if、implements、import、instanceof、int、interface、long、

native、new、null、package、private、protected、public、return、short、static、

strictfp、super、switch、synchronized、this、throw、throws、transient、true、try、

void、volatile、while

编写Java程序时,需要注意以下几点

  1. 所有的关键字都是小写的
  2. 不能使用关键字命名标识符
  3. const和goto是保留字关键字,虽然在Java中还没有任何意义,但在程序中不能用来作为自定义的标识符
  4. true,false和null虽然不属于关键字,但它们具有特殊的意义,也不能作为标识符使用

Java中的常量

什么是变量

在程序运行期间,随时可能产生一些临时数据,应用程序会将这些数据保存在内存单元中,每个内存单元都用一个标识符来标识,这些用于标识内存单元的标识符就称为变量。

变量的数据类型

  • 整数类型所占存储空间大小及取值范围
类型 占用空间 取值范围
byte 8位(1个字节) -27~27-1
short 16位(2个字节) -215~215-1
int 32位(4个字节) -231~231-1
long 64位(8个字节) -263~263-1
  • 浮点类型所占存储空间大小及取值范围
类型 占用空间 取值范围
float 32位(4个字节) 1.4E-453.4E+38,-3.4E+38-1.4E-45
double 64位(8个字节) 4.9E-3241.7E+308,-1.7E+308-4.9E-324
posted @ 2021-12-10 18:01  灵天逸和江辰希  阅读(155)  评论(0)    收藏  举报